structure DXGKARG_SETTIMINGSFROMVIDPN (d3dkmddi.h)
Utilisé pour contenir les arguments de DXGKDDI_SETTIMINGSFROMVIDPN.
Syntaxe
typedef struct _DXGKARG_SETTIMINGSFROMVIDPN {
D3DKMDT_HVIDPN hFunctionalVidPn;
DXGK_SET_TIMING_FLAGS SetFlags;
PDXGK_SET_TIMING_RESULTS pResultsFlags;
UINT PathCount;
DXGK_SET_TIMING_PATH_INFO *pSetTimingPathInfo;
} DXGKARG_SETTIMINGSFROMVIDPN;
Membres
hFunctionalVidPn
Handle à un D3DKMDT_HVIDPN qui représente un VidPn fonctionnel qui décrit la configuration d’affichage que le système d’exploitation tente d’appliquer.
Le type de données D3DKMDT_HVIDPN est défini dans D3dkmdt.h.
SetFlags
Une structure DXGK_SET_TIMING_FLAGS qui demande des actions spécifiques du pilote sur l’appel SetTimingsFromVidPn.
pResultsFlags
Pointeur vers une structure DXGK_SET_TIMING_RESULTS que le pilote doit utiliser pour signaler les résultats globaux de l’appel SetTimingsFromVidPn .
PathCount
Nombre de pointeurs dans le tableau pointé vers pSetTimingPathInfo.
pSetTimingPathInfo
Tableau de pointeurs vers DXGK_SET_TIMING_PATH_INFO structures qui spécifient les détails par chemin d’accès des minutages à définir. Il permet également d’envoyer des commentaires du pilote sur le travail supplémentaire que le système d’exploitation doit effectuer avant que les modifications de minutage puissent être effectuées, ou une fois les modifications terminées.
Configuration requise
Condition requise | Valeur |
---|---|
En-tête | d3dkmddi.h |